Можно ли обеспечить горизонтальное масштабирование Kafka для обработки увеличивающихся потоков данных?
Когда целесообразно избегать использования всех доступных ядер для запуска программного кода?
Какова роль компонента Outbox в архитектуре системы и почему его используют?
Когда и почему возвращаемое значение сохраняется на стеке, а когда — в куче?
В каком месте в коде происходят объявления переменных внутри функции?
Каким образом организовано распределение и структура памяти в компьютере?
Объясните различия между управлением памятью в стеке и в куче в контексте программирования.
Каким образом осуществляется доступ к значениям по ключам в структуре данных Map?
Каким образом можно эффективно запустить и управлять большим числом горутин, например, около 100 тысяч?
Какой у тебя опыт работы в области разработки программных решений?
Какая структура данных в языке Go аналогична формату JSON?
В каких случаях применение кэширования может привести к негативным последствиям или уменьшить эффективность системы?
Какова основная задача и преимущества использования Protocol Buffers в обмене данными?
Каким образом реализовать мониторинг и диагностику проблем с подключением к базе данных?
Можно ли изменять содержимое массива, переданного в виде слайса, в процессе выполнения программы?
Возможно ли выполнить одновременную запись данных в канал без использования буфера?
В каких ситуациях срабатывает блок default в конструкции Select?
В каких случаях вызовы системных вызовов работают быстрее: в процессах PostgreSQL или в горутинах внутри приложения?
Можете объяснить механизм получения данных из канала в программировании?
В каком месте создаваемая горутина резервирует память в процессе выполнения?